Clutch

Clutch

"Things are worse than they thought."

Detectives Clutch and Angel navigate a criminal underworld with the help of three women, whom Clutch is familiar with, to solve the disappearance of a group of women. Their investigations take them deeper into unknown and even more corrupt places in the underworld, that are worse than they thought.

Release Date

October 29, 2024

Status

Released

Original Title

Clutch

Runtime

1h 23min

Budget

Revenue

Language

English

Production Companies